Bulawayo Airport vs Amsterdam Island Climate & Distance Between

French Southern Lands flag
  • The distance between Bulawayo Airport, Zimbabwe and Amsterdam Island, French Southern Lands is approximately 5,091 km or 3,164 mi.
  • To reach Bulawayo Airport in this distance one would set out from Amsterdam Island bearing 278.6°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Bulawayo Airport bearing 303.8° or NW .
  • Bulawayo Airport has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Amsterdam Island has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• The annual mean temperature is 5.1 °C (9.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.2 °C (4°F) more in Bulawayo Airport.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 555 mm (21.9 in) less which is equivalent to 555 l/m² (13.62 US gal/ft²) or 5,550,000 l/ha (593,332 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.7° higher in Bulawayo Airport than in Amsterdam Island.
